Cookies: Our Services may use "cookies" and similar technologies (collectively, "cookies"). Cookies are small text files this Website sends to your computer for recordkeeping purposes; this information is stored in a file on your computer's hard drive. Cookies make web surfing and browsing easier for you by saving your preferences so we can use these to improve your next visit to our Website.
Data Collected Automatically: In addition to any Personal Information or other information that you choose to provide to us on the Services, we and our third-party service providers may use a variety of technologies, now and hereafter devised, that automatically collect certain web site usage information whenever you visit or interact with the Services. This information may include browser type, operating system, the page served, the time, the source of the request, the preceding page view, and other similar information. We may use this usage information for a variety of purposes, including to enhance or otherwise improve the Services. In addition, we may also collect your IP address or some other unique identifier for the particular device you use to access the Internet, as applicable (collectively, referred to herein as a "Device Identifier"). A Device Identifier is a number that is automatically assigned to your device, and we may identify your device by its Device Identifier. When analyzed, usage information helps us determine how our Services are used, such as what types of visitors arrive at the Services, what type of content is most popular, what type of content you may find most relevant and what type of visitors are interested in particular kinds of content and advertising. We may associate your Device Identifier or web site usage information with the Personal Information you provide, but we will treat the combined information as Personal Information.
We use non-personal information in a variety of ways, including to help analyze site traffic, understand customer needs and trends, carry out targeted promotional activities and to improve our services.
As aggregated or anonymized information does not constitute Personal Information, we may use it for any purpose.

Shine the Light Law: If you are a resident of California, California Civil Code Section 1798.83 allows you to request information regarding the Personal Information we collected and third parties to whom we disclosed your Personal Information for the third parties' direct marketing purposes during the preceding calendar year. To send this request, you may contact us using one of the methods in the “How Can You Contact Us?” section of this Privacy Notice.
2. California Consumer Privacy Act (“CCPA”): This section 2 is intended to satisfy the requirements of the California Consumer Privacy Act (“CCPA”). This section supplements our Privacy Notice. The rights herein are in addition to any other rights applicable to you in this Privacy Notice. Where there is a conflict between this section and other provisions of this Privacy Notice, this section will prevail for California residents and their rights under the CCPA and applicable California law.
a) Personal Information Definition:
For the CCPA, “Personal Information” is any information that identifies, relates to, describes, is reasonably capable of being associated with, or could reasonably be linked, directly or indirectly, with a particular individual or household.
b) Exclusions:
Some Personal Information is not subject to the CCPA such as consumer credit reports and background checks, publicly available data lawfully made available from state or federal government records, and any other Personal Information exempt from the CCPA. This CCPA section does not apply to our employees. A separate privacy notice applies to our employees.

f) SELLING YOUR PERSONAL INFORMATION: Based on the CCPA's broad definition of "sale," certain data collection on our sites and applications by third parties for purposes of internet-based advertising and social media tools, as well as some other activities involving the disclosure of personal information to another business or a third party, may be a "sale" under the CCPA even if we do not share your information for money. Under some circumstances as described below, we may "sell" or license your Personal Information under this broad definition.
